It seems like an easy point to do when marketing a residential or commercial property: just hand over the keys and consist of an "as-is" clause in the contract. pasadena buy home. It's more facility than it appears, and it does not suggest the customer can not back out of the sale or that the vendor has no duties.




controling what have to be divulged to purchasers prior to they authorize a contract, despite an as-is condition included. In Washington, D.C., vendors have to stick to the DC Code's Vendor Disclosure Demands or they risk facing lawful fines. The code requires they reveal in creating any kind of recognized facts or issues concerning the residential or commercial property in inquiry.

If a vendor needs to divulge so a lot, you might wonder what as-is stipulations imply and what their objective is. Simply put, The customer can do a home assessment (and should!), however they agree that the vendor is exempt for resolving problems that the examination discovers. When developing an as-is statement, it ought to be clear and specific.


It also needs to state that the seller is not supplying any type of guarantees or guarantees regarding the home's problem. Here's an instance: "The Vendor is offering the Residential or commercial property in "As-Is" condition, with all faults. The Customer recognizes and accepts that Buyer is buying the Home in its present condition and without any representations, guarantees, or warranties from Seller, either shared or indicated, regarding viability or condition - best pasadena real estate agent." in Washington, D.C

Find out more concerning what the term "as is" means in actual estate contracts, along with the advantages and downsides of buying a residential or commercial property on those terms. If you remain in the market for a new home, you may have found the term "as is" in a realty listing.


The lawful term "as is" in a created agreement methods that the purchaser need to want to accept the home in its current condition. If you are the purchaser, this means that you forgo the possibility to ask the vendor to make any repair services or lower the rate based on troubles the building might have.

It limits the vendor's responsibility for repairs and often results in a set list price - best pasadena realtors. Customers taking into consideration such contracts need to continue with care and may desire to spending plan for potential post-purchase costs. What are the vital elements of a genuine estate agreement that's "as is"? Several key items are typically consisted of: A comprehensive description of the home for sale.


Any type of recognized concerns or issues that the seller is eager to reveal. Stipulations pertaining to the customer's choice to conduct examinations and the conditions for doing so.


If a residential or commercial property is detailed "as is," this suggests that the vendor will not make any repairs or give any kind of rate decrease for troubles of the whole residential property, that includes both the home and the grounds. Some common concerns covered by an "as is" summary could include leaks, mold and mildew or mold, or significant architectural problems, to name simply a couple of.
